[Follicular dynamics of first-wave in ewes treated with prostaglandin [PGF 2alpha] vs. CIDR followed by 500 UI of ECG]. Abstract: Fourteen ewes were used and subdivided in 2 groups. Group 1 was synchronized by 2 i.m. injections of PGF2? and, Group 2 was treated for 14 d with CIDR and 500 IU of eCG at dispositive withdrawal on day 14. Ovarian follicular dynamics were ultrasonically monitored. Blood samples for P4 determination were collected daily from 1 d before of first injection of PGF2? until day 10 after ovulation. The CIDR + eCG treatment enhanced the maximum diameter [p<0,05] and growth rate [p<0,001] of dominant follicle during wave 1. |

Monogeneans are ectoparasites that may cause losses in production and productivity in the aquaculture of Colossoma macropomum. Chemotherapeutics used in aquaculture usually have major adverse effects on fish; hence, the use of essential oils has been considered advantageous, but these are not soluble in water. Thus, the use of nanostructures to enhance water solubility of compounds and improve bioactivity may be very promising. This study investigated the antiparasitic activity of nanoemulsion prepared with Copaifera officinalis oleoresin (50, 100, 150, 200 and 300 mg/L), against monogenean parasites from the gills of C. macropomum. The particle size distribution and zeta potential suggested that a potentially kinetic stable system was generated. The nanoemulsion from C. officinalis oleoresin achieved high efficacy (100%) at low concentrations (200 and 300 mg/L) after 15 min of exposure. This was the first time that a nanoemulsion was generated from C. officinalis oleoresin using a solvent-free, non-heating and low-energy method. Moreover, this was the first time that an antiparasitic against monogeneans on fish gills, based on nanoemulsion of C. officinalis oleoresin, was tested. |
